 The Poe Decoder - "The Fall of the House of Usher"   (Site not responding. Last check: 2007-10-21)
Roderick and his twin sister Madeline are the last of the all time-honored "House of Usher." They are both suffering from rather strange illnesses which may be attributed to the intermarriage of the family.
Roderick suffers from "a morbid acuteness of the senses"; while Madeline's illness is characterized by "...a settled apathy, a gradual wasting away of the person, and frequent although transient affections of a partly cataleptical character..." which caused her to lose consciousness and feeling.
Roderick and Madeline are not just brother and sister but twins who share "sympathies of a scarcely intelligible nature" which connect his mental disintegration to her physical decline.

 Roderic -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Pelayo returned to his native Asturias (in the northern part of modern day Spain) and became the leader of a rebellion against Munuza, the Moorish governor of the area.
The English writers Walter Scott, Walter Savage Landor, and Robert Southey had handled the legends associated with these events poetically: Scott in "The Vision of Don Roderick" in 1811, Landor in his tragedy Count Julian in 1812, and Southey in Roderick, the Last of the Goths in 1814.
The American writer Washington Irving retells the legends in his 1835 Legends of the Conquest of Spain, mostly written while living in that country.

 Amazon.com: RODERICK VOL 1: Books: John Sladek   (Site not responding. Last check: 2007-10-21)
Roderick is a learning machine - the product of a highly experimental artificial intelligence project at the University of Minnetonka.
Roderick escapes and is adopted, bought or just kidnapped by one after another crazy person - beginning with a disfunctional couple who neglect him.
There's obsessive artists, craven academics, moronic TV shows and general satirising of all the crass things we've come to accept as inescapable parts of modern life in the twenty years since the book was written.
